DIVISIONAL OUTLOOK: AL Central—Stubbs, Getz, Keppinger to lose time?

Cleveland Indians

With Michael Bourn (OF, CLE) scheduled to come off the DL soon, Drew Stubbs (OF, CLE) is a candidate to lose playing time via a possible platoon with Michael Brantley (OF, CLE). Stubbs is hitting .225 and has a history of having difficulty hitting right-handed pitching (.186 in 2012, .226 in 2011). Brantley has hit right-handers at a .285 clip for his career and could take the majority of the ABs in a platoon situation. If the Indians went with a platoon in left, Bourn would play center with Nick Swisher in right field. Mark Reynolds would play 1B, with Jason Giambi (1B/DH, CLE), Ryan Raburn (2B/OF, CLE), or Carlos Santana (C, CLE) filling in at DH.
